CSS圖像透明設(shè)置方法
在CSS中,我們可以使用opacity
屬性來設(shè)置圖像的透明度。opacity
屬性的值范圍從0到1,其中0表示完全透明,1表示完全不透明,以下是一個示例:
img { opacity: 0.5; }
上述代碼將圖像的不透明度設(shè)置為50%。
我們還可以使用rgba
顏色值來設(shè)置圖像的透明度。rgba
顏色值的***后一個參數(shù)表示透明度,其值范圍同樣是從0到1,以下是一個示例:
img { background-color: rgba(255, 0, 0, 0.5); }
上述代碼將圖像的背景色設(shè)置為紅色,并將不透明度設(shè)置為50%。
需要注意的是,opacity
屬性會使其子元素也變?yōu)橥该?,?code>rgba顏色值則只會改變元素本身的透明度,在選擇使用哪種方法時,需要根據(jù)具體的需求和場景來決定。
除了以上兩種方法外,我們還可以使用其他CSS屬性來實現(xiàn)圖像的透明效果,例如mix-blend-mode
和filter
等,這些屬性都可以幫助我們更好地控制圖像的透明度效果。